Technical Challenges: Extreme Performance Requirements of Energy Storage Capacitors in Airbag ECUs

The operating characteristics of airbag ECUs impose multi-dimensional extreme technical requirements on energy storage capacitors, primarily focusing on three aspects: low-temperature performance, high-temperature lifespan, and cycle durability.

Low-Temperature Challenge (-40?): In extremely low-temperature environments, the ECU has stringent requirements for instantaneous discharge current and voltage sustainment time. The capacitor's ESR (Electrostatic Dissipation Rate) increases sharply with low temperatures, directly leading to increased voltage drop, affecting energy conversion efficiency, and consequently threatening system stability and safety.

High-Temperature and Lifespan Challenge (105?): At the extreme temperature of 105?, electrolyte drying easily causes capacitor capacity decay, ultimately leading to device failure. Capacitor lifespan at this temperature is the ultimate test of the stability of its material system and manufacturing process.

Cyclical Stress: Airbag ECUs must withstand 100,000 charge-discharge cycles. The capacitor's electrode foil and electrolyte must possess high durability to ensure stable performance during frequent self-tests.

Data Verification: Core Performance Comparison of Yongming LK Series and NCC LBV Series

Through laboratory testing, the core performance indicators of the Yongming LK series and NCC LBV series were verified side-by-side. The results are as follows:

-40? Low-Temperature ESR Comparison: Under the test conditions of -40?/120Hz, the ESR value of the Yongming LK series is 97.72m?, while that of the NCC LBV series is 106.93m?. The LK series' ESR value is reduced by approximately 9.2m?, significantly improving the energy conversion efficiency of the system's low-temperature discharge current and providing a higher safety margin for the airbag ECU.

105? High-Temperature Lifespan and Capacitance Decay: After 3000 hours of testing at 105?, the capacitance decay of the Yung-Ming LK series was -2.71%, and that of the NCC LBV series was -2.72%. The highly similar decay data demonstrates that the Yung-Ming LK series possesses long-term high-temperature operational stability comparable to industry benchmarks.

Replacement Implementation: Engineering and Commercial Considerations from Laboratory to Production Line

Successfully replacing the NCC LBG/LBV series with the Yung-Ming LK series requires balancing engineering design verification with commercial supply chain value, and ensuring comprehensive process control:

1. Design Verification of Core Checklist

Electrical Compatibility Confirmation: Focus on verifying key parameters such as operating voltage and ripple current to ensure the replacement solution is compatible with the ECU system and guarantees normal operation;

Layout and Soldering Compatibility: Even minor dimensional differences in capacitors can cause stress on the PCB board, requiring detailed board-level verification to mitigate application risks.
